This is a purity and identity analysis. Sterility, endotoxins, and heavy metals were not screened — a high purity figure says nothing about those.

About this test

Independent HPLC purity analysis of NAD+ from directpeptides.com, performed by Horizon Analytical on March 15, 2026. Reported purity: 99.52%. Net content: 1000.2 mg against 1000 mg labeled (100% of label). Batch DPS-6690114. Sample source: shop-provided. Certificate of analysis attached.
